Inspectorate Update – Further 88 Animals Seized from South-West Sydney Property

On Thursday, 10 September 2026, RSPCA NSW Inspectors executed a search warrant at a property in South-West Sydney after previously issued written directions were not complied with.

During the operation a large number of the dogs were found inside the dwelling. 88 dogs of various breeds were seized, including one deceased puppy.

All surviving animals were admitted into our care, where they are undergoing veterinary assessments and receiving treatment as needed.

RSPCA NSW Inspectors previously attended this property in July 2026, seizing 10 dogs and humanely euthanising one goat on veterinary advice.

This takes the total number of animals seized from this property to 98. 

This matter still remains under investigation.
